Warning Signs You Need Multi-Family Water Damage Restoration

Catching water damage early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. But how do you know when to call a professional? Here are some warning signs you shouldn’t ignore: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ors in your multi-family home can be a sign of hidden water damage. Don’t ignore these odors, they can show a bigger problem.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age, particularly in areas with high foot traffic. Address these issues quickly to prevent further damage.

Stains on Walls or Ceilings

Stains on wal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age, particularly if they’re accompanied by musty odors or warping. Don’t ignore these stains, they can show a bigger problem.

Discoloration or Fading

Discoloration or fading of carpets, upholstery, or other materials can be a sign of water damage. Address these issues quickly to prevent further damage.

Unusual Sounds or Sights

Unusual sounds or sights in your multi-family home, such as dripping water or water spots, can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, they can show a bigger problem.

Increased Humidity

Increased humidity in your multi-family home can be a sign of water damage, particularly if it’s accompanied by musty odors or warping. Address these issues quickly to prevent further damage.

Multi-Family Water Damage Restoration Cost in Prosper, TX

The cost of multi-family water damage restoration varies based on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Prosper, TX. These estimates are based on average costs and may vary depending on your specific situation. Get a free estimate today and find out how much it will cost to restore your property.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Containment $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, complexity of job
Water Extraction $1,000 – $5,000 Amount of water extracted, equipment used
Drying and Dehumidification $1,500 – $6,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used
Cleaning and Sanitizing $1,000 – $3,000 Size of affected area, type of cleaning products used
Final Inspection and Restoration $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, complexity of job
More Services (e.g., mold remediation) $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of mold growth, size of affected area

Common Questions About Multi-Family Water Damage Restoration

Q: Will my insurance cover the cost of water damage restoration?

A: Yes, most insurance policies cover water damage restoration. But, the specifics of your policy will find out the extent of coverage. Our team will work with you to navigate the process and ensure fair compensation. We’ll help you get the coverage you need.

Q: How long does water damage restoration take?

A: The length of time for water damage restoration varies dep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Typically, it takes 3-5 days to complete the restoration process. We’ll work efficiently to get your property back to normal.

Q: Is water damage restoration a DIY project?

A: No, water damage restoration is not a DIY project. It needs specialized equipment and expertise to ensure safety and prevent further damage. Don’t risk your safety and property, call a pro.

Q: Can I prevent water damage in my multi-family home?

A: Yes, you can prevent water damage in your multi-family home by regular maintenance, inspecting pipes and appliances, and addressing leaks quickly. Regular maintenance can save you time and money in the long run.
